#6e4931 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e4931 is composed of 43.1% red, 28.6%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 55.5%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 23.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.4% and a lightness of 31.2%. #6e4931 color hex could be obtained by blending #dc9262 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#6e4931 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e4931 has RGB values of R:110, G:73,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.55,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7227697.

Shades and Tints of #6e4931
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#faf6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e4931
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#564e49 is the less saturated color, while #9f3f00 is the most saturated one.
